Helm of Nabu. Random pools. Pools will appear on the floor from time to time but their effect is random each time they appear. It can be: Damage Dealing, Damage Buff, Power or Slow. It's recommended to avoid the pools each time until their effect can be determined. Skeets Power pools on the floor. Provides power if you are standing in them. Unconfirmed: May be random Power Ring Spawns green orbs that bounce and ground you if you're too close to them. Trident of Poseidon Damage Buff pools on the floor. Standing in them will provide a damage buff (This means players AND bosses get a damage buff) - Useful for players to stand in them while making sure bosses are not. Blue Beetle Scarab Damage Buff pools on the floor. Standing in them will provide a damage buff (This means players AND bosses get a damage buff) - Useful for players to stand in them while making sure bosses are not. Nth Metal Power pools on the floor. Provides power if you are standing in them. H Dial Summons two metahumans at a time. They often blockbreak the tank so it's recommended to wipe them out quickly. (They often appear and lunge at a target immediately) - The adds themselves can hit somewhat hard but are very easy to take down. White Dwarf Shard Damage pools on the floor. Standing in them causes damage to players and bosses alike. Having the tank try and position the bosses in the pools is a quick way to take them down (Mind you tank needs to be OUTSIDE the pool or they will take too much damage) Responsometer Spawns metal men adds. Two at a time. Similar to the H Dial artifact. The adds can hit somewhat hard but are very easy to take down. Clay of the Gods Power pools on the floor. Provides power if you are standing in them. Tantu Totem Damage pools on the floor. Standing in them causes damage to players and bosses alike. Having the tank try and position the bosses in the pools is a quick way to take them down (Mind you tank needs to be OUTSIDE the pool or they will take too much damage) Superman DNA Spawns orbs that bounce you around. Seems to be a bit more "intense" compared to the Green Lantern Power Ring artifact.

Yeah, but they're double-edged swords. Damage buff: Great if you guys stand in them, bad if the bosses. Damage-dealing: Great if the bosses stand in them, bad if you stand in them. Power: More of the middle of the road. Haven't seen it really be too detrimental if the bosses stand in them. And helps the group by providing +50 tics of power every second or so.
Should the tank be rolling out of the damage dealing swirls? I've seen some wipes where the tank got caught in it and healers had some trouble keeping the health up.
Yeah. The tank should not be standing in the damage-dealing swirls. While a great healer may be able to keep them alive it's unnecessary extra damage. The best case in my opinion is for the tank to try and stand on the edge of the pool (slightly outside of it's effect range) and the bosses will be inside the effect range. Depending on your boss combo this is sometimes easier. For example Space Commander is often at a bit of a range to the tank so he tends to be easier to position in a pool.
